Combined Echocardiography and Exercise Symposium
The Graduate Hotel | Cincinnati, OH |
March 6-7, 2026
Thank you for Joining us for the 2026 Combined Echocardiography and Exercise Symposium!
Conference programing will address the evaluation, treatment, and natural course for single ventricle physiology and related cardiopulmonary dysfunction as well as post operative care. In the afternoon, separate tracks will address cardiopulmonary exercise testing and management as well as the echocardiographic evaluation related to patient development and disease progression. Case presentations from clinical exercise physiologists and pediatric sonographers will address unique aspects in diagnosis and treatment in this clinical spectrum.
Audience
Clinical exercise and rehabilitation professionals, physicians, sonographers, allied health professionals, nurses and students are invited to attend this innovative program.

Accreditation
In support of improving patient care, Cincinnati Children’s Hospital Medical Center is jointly accredited by the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(ACCME), the Accreditation Council for Pharmacy Education (ACPE), and the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C), to provide continuing education for the healthcare team.
Physicians: This activity has been approved for AMA PRA Category 1 Credit™.
Nurses: This activity is approved for continuing nursing education (CNE) contact hours.
IPCE: This activity was planned by and for the healthcare team, and learners will receive Interprofessional Continuing Education (IPCE) credits for learning and change.
